2. Wireless Video Doorbells

Wireless video doorbells are an excellent alternative for outdoor surveillance and visitor monitoring. Equipped with high-resolution cameras, night vision, and two-way audio, they allow homeowners to see and communicate with visitors from anywhere. Notable models like Ring Video Doorbell 4 and Nest Doorbell offer cloud storage options and integration with existing security networks.

4. AI-Powered Surveillance Cameras

AI-enhanced cameras are transforming home security by offering features like facial recognition, activity alerts, and object detection. These cameras can differentiate between humans, pets, and inanimate objects, reducing false alarms. 5. Hidden and Discreet Cameras

For covert surveillance, discreet cameras are becoming more sophisticated. Miniature cameras disguised as everyday objects—such as clocks, picture frames, or smoke detectors—allow homeowners to monitor sensitive areas without drawing attention.
